Output 18d7a427d5e70b915928ef20df5d03c794b27e7e59e683fdb488adff06eb49ce:0

value
1477162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48e59d864c938bbc948a5a7c029d962513c5dd2 OP_EQUAL
address
3KcJtrrvYENrnFK9JkEED3tEj6NR5mxSpg
transaction
18d7a427d5e70b915928ef20df5d03c794b27e7e59e683fdb488adff06eb49ce
spent
true